PARKING LAMP (CLEARANCE LAMP)

1.

Turn lighting switch OFF.

2.

Remove air cleaner case (when replacing LH bulb). Refer to 

EM-16, "AIR CLEANER AND AIR DUCT"

   in

“EM” section.

3.

Remove IPDM E/R (when replacing RH bulb). Refer to 

PG-29, "Removal and Installation of IPDM E/R"

   in

“PG” section. 

4.

Turn bulb socket counterclockwise and unlock it.

5.

Remove bulb from its socket.

6.

Installation is the reverse order of removal.

FRONT TURN SIGNAL LAMP

1.

Turn lighting switch OFF.

2.

Remove fender protector (front). Refer to 

EI-22, "FENDER PROTECTOR"

   in “EI” section.

3.

Turn bulb socket counterclockwise and unlock it.

4.

Remove bulb from its socket.

5.

Installation is the reverse order of removal.

CAUTION:

After installing bulb, be sure to install plastic cap and bulb socket securely to insure watertight-
ness.

System Description

AKS007NF

Daytime light system turns ON daytime light lamps (front fog lamps) while driving. Daytime light lamps are not
turned ON if engine is activated with parking brake ON. Release parking brake to turn on daytime light lamps.
The lamps turn OFF when lighting switch is in the 2ND position or AUTO position (headlamp is ON) and when
lighting switch is in the PASSING position. (Daytime light lamps are not turned off only by parking brake itself.)
A parking brake signal and engine run or stop signal are sent to BCM (body control module) by CAN commu-
nication line, and control daytime light system.

DAYTIME LIGHT OPERATION

With the engine running, the lighting switch in the OFF or 1ST position and parking brake released, the CPU
located in the IPDM E/R grounds the coil side of the fog lamp relay. The fog lamp relay then directs power

through IPDM E/R terminal 37

to front fog lamp LH terminal 1,

through IPDM E/R terminal 36

to front fog lamp RH terminal 1.

Ground is supplied

to front fog lamp LH terminal 2

through grounds E13, E26 and E28,

to front fog lamp RH terminal 2

through grounds E13, E26 and E28.

With power and grounds supplied, the front fog lamps illuminate.

EXTERIOR LAMP BATTERY SAVER CONTROL

With the combination switch (lighting switch) is in the 2ND position (ON), and the ignition switch is turned from
ON or ACC to OFF, the battery saver control function is activated.
Under this condition, the front fog lamps remain illuminated for 5 minutes, and then the front fog lamps are
turned off.
Exterior lamp battery saver control made can be changed by the function setting of CONSULT-II.

CAN Communication System Description

AKS007NG

CAN (Controller Area Network) is a serial communication line for real time application. It is an on-vehicle mul-
tiplex communication line with high data communication speed and excellent error detection ability. Many elec-
tronic control units are equipped onto a vehicle, and each control unit shares information and links with other
control units during operation (not independent). In CAN communication, control units are connected with 2
communication lines (CAN H line, CAN L line) allowing a high rate of information transmission with less wiring.
Each control unit transmits/receives data but selectively reads required data only.
